public static function provideParseTitle_invalid() {
//TODO: test unicode errors
return array(
array( '#' ),
array( '::' ),
array( '::xx' ),
array( '::##' ),
array( ' :: x' ),
array( 'Talk:File:Foo.jpg' ),
array( 'Talk:localtestiw:Foo' ),
array( 'remotetestiw:Foo' ),
array( '::1' ), // only valid in user namespace
array( 'User::x' ), // leading ":" in a user name is only valid of IPv6 addresses
//NOTE: cases copied from TitleTest::testSecureAndSplit. Keep in sync.
array( '' ),
array( ':' ),
array( '__ __' ),
array( ' __ ' ),
// Bad characters forbidden regardless of wgLegalTitleChars
array( 'A [ B' ),
array( 'A ] B' ),
array( 'A { B' ),
array( 'A } B' ),
array( 'A < B' ),
array( 'A > B' ),
array( 'A | B' ),
// URL encoding
array( 'A%20B' ),
array( 'A%23B' ),
array( 'A%2523B' ),
// XML/HTML character entity references
// Note: Commented out because they are not marked invalid by the PHP test as
// Title::newFromText runs Sanitizer::decodeCharReferencesAndNormalize first.
//array( 'A &eacute; B' ),
//array( 'A &#233; B' ),
//array( 'A &#x00E9; B' ),
// Subject of NS_TALK does not roundtrip to NS_MAIN
array( 'Talk:File:Example.svg' ),
// Directory navigation
array( '.' ),
array( '..' ),
array( './Sandbox' ),
array( '../Sandbox' ),
array( 'Foo/./Sandbox' ),
array( 'Foo/../Sandbox' ),
array( 'Sandbox/.' ),
array( 'Sandbox/..' ),
// Tilde
array( 'A ~~~ Name' ),
array( 'A ~~~~ Signature' ),
array( 'A ~~~~~ Timestamp' ),
array( str_repeat( 'x', 256 ) ),
// Namespace prefix without actual title
array( 'Talk:' ),
array( 'Category: ' ),
array( 'Category: #bar' )
);
}
/**
* @dataProvider provideParseTitle_invalid
*/
public function testParseTitle_invalid( $text ) {
$this->setExpectedException( 'MalformedTitleException' );
$codec = $this->makeCodec( 'en' );
$codec->parseTitle( $text, NS_MAIN );
}
